> Here's the reason.
> Under OpenBSD, INSTALL_PROGRAM is defined in 
> infrastructure/mk/bsd.port.mk and it strips by default. The configure 
> script of gnustep-make picks it up and add it to config.make.
Ah, that makes the difference.

> 
> Anyway, config.make is a config file, just change it to your needs.
